A Legacy Woven in Gabardine:
The story begins with Thomas Burberry's invention of gabardine in 1879. This revolutionary tightly woven, waterproof cotton fabric was a game-changer. Unlike its predecessors, gabardine was both durable and breathable, resisting rain and wind while remaining comfortable to wear. This innovation formed the foundation for the iconic Burberry trench coat, a garment that would become synonymous with the brand and a symbol of British style globally. The Craftsmanship of a Masterpiece:
The quality of a Burberry gabardine coat is undeniable. Made in England, using traditional techniques passed down through generations, each coat is a testament to meticulous craftsmanship. The shower-resistant cotton gabardine itself is a marvel of textile engineering, its tight weave repelling water while allowing for breathability. The iconic Burberry Check lining, a signature detail, adds a touch of understated luxury, visible when the coat is open or the collar is turned up. This attention to detail is what sets a Burberry gabardine coat apart from imitations. The precise stitching, the perfectly placed buttons, and the overall feel of the garment speak volumes about the dedication to quality inherent in the brand's heritage.
